Output 26e51ba81b154dd55f7db940265f84df609fe0f145673a5657aec8a9747146f3:1

value
153543
script pubkey
OP_0 OP_PUSHBYTES_20 8b6e839b99a45660e5c637f5ab143fd83a2404d9
address
bc1q3dhg8xue53txpewxxl66k9plmqazgpxe444ryv
transaction
26e51ba81b154dd55f7db940265f84df609fe0f145673a5657aec8a9747146f3
confirmations
61773
spent
false